From the supplier: Comptroller of the Currency Eugene Ludwig has come under fire from House Banking Committee Chmn Jim Leach for marshalling the banking industry to oppose a financial services reform bill supported by Leach. Leach points to the opposition of H.R. 10 by the American Bankers Assn and claims it was probably the result of a conference call Ludwig had with the association during which he spoke about his opposition to the bill.
